Paint the Town Red

Paint the Town Red

The Restaurant that Totally Isn't a Cult
2 条留言
Stealthy Scoot  [作者] 11 月 2 日 上午 10:51 
The red keycard is located on the shelf in the kitchen freezer. You need to get the blue keycard first to get to it
Jchen179 10 月 31 日 上午 1:42 
where is the red keycard located?